In an unprecedented show of solidarity, around 10,000 people took to the streets of Lismore today – to declare the region gasfield free.

It’s the biggest social movement of its kind in the region, which is calling on the government to ban unconventional gas mining.

 

The huge crowd saturated Lismore’s CBD today, in a unified stance against mining and exploration on the north coast.

Mayors of both Lismore and Clarence Valley accepted letters from community members, declaring themselves CSG free.

Lismore March 2 01-11-2014

Lismore Mayor Jenny Dowell says the State Government and mining companies must listen.

"Look, the message is this community does not want coal-seam gas," she said.

"The people in the city need to listen to this, because our region is where they get their food.
